ChatGPT란? AI 챗봇의 원리와 활용 방법



ChatGPT란? AI 챗봇의 원리와 활용 방법

AI 챗봇은 현대 사회에서 점점 더 중요한 역할을 하고 있습니다. 그 중에서도 ChatGPT는 인공지능 기반의 대화형 모델로, 사용자와 자연스러운 대화를 나눌 수 있는 능력을 가지고 있습니다. 이 글에서는 ChatGPT의 기본 개념, 작동 원리, 그리고 다양한 활용 방법에 대해 깊이 있게 살펴보겠습니다.

ChatGPT의 기본 개념

ChatGPT는 OpenAI에서 개발한 대화형 AI 모델로, “Generative Pre-trained Transformer”의 약자입니다. 이 모델은 자연어 처리(NLP) 기술을 기반으로 하며, 대량의 텍스트 데이터를 바탕으로 학습되었습니다. 이러한 학습 과정을 통해 ChatGPT는 인간과 유사한 방식으로 대화할 수 있는 능력을 갖추게 되었습니다.



ChatGPT는 대화의 맥락을 이해하고, 그에 적합한 응답을 생성하는 데 특화되어 있습니다. 이는 단순히 질문에 대한 답변을 제공하는 것에 그치지 않고, 사용자의 의도와 감정을 파악하여 보다 자연스럽고 유의미한 대화를 이끌어낼 수 있도록 설계되었습니다. 따라서 ChatGPT는 단순한 정보 검색 도구가 아니라, 사람과의 소통을 통해 더 많은 가치를 창출할 수 있는 존재로 자리 잡고 있습니다.

AI 챗봇의 작동 원리

ChatGPT의 작동 원리는 크게 두 가지 단계로 나눌 수 있습니다: 사전 학습(pre-training)과 미세 조정(fine-tuning)입니다. 사전 학습 단계에서는 방대한 양의 텍스트 데이터를 사용하여 모델이 언어의 구조와 패턴을 이해하도록 합니다. 이 과정에서 모델은 문법, 어휘, 의미론 등을 학습하게 됩니다.



이후 미세 조정 단계에서는 특정 작업에 맞춰 모델을 조정합니다. 예를 들어, 대화형 AI의 경우 사용자와의 상호작용을 통해 더 나은 응답을 생성할 수 있도록 모델을 훈련시키는 것입니다. 이 단계에서는 사용자 피드백이나 특정 데이터셋을 활용하여 모델의 성능을 개선합니다.

ChatGPT는 Transformer 아키텍처를 기반으로 하고 있으며, 이는 모델이 입력된 텍스트의 각 단어 간의 관계를 효과적으로 이해할 수 있도록 돕습니다. Transformer는 자기 주의(attention) 메커니즘을 사용하여 문맥을 고려한 응답을 생성하는 데 강력한 성능을 발휘합니다. 이러한 기술 덕분에 ChatGPT는 대화의 흐름을 자연스럽게 이어갈 수 있습니다.

ChatGPT의 활용 방법

ChatGPT는 다양한 분야에서 활용될 수 있습니다. 그 중 몇 가지 주요 활용 방법을 살펴보겠습니다.

1. 고객 지원

많은 기업들이 ChatGPT를 고객 지원 시스템에 통합하여 사용하고 있습니다. 고객의 질문에 신속하고 정확하게 응답할 수 있는 능력 덕분에, 기업은 고객 만족도를 높이고 운영 비용을 절감할 수 있습니다. 예를 들어, 온라인 쇼핑몰에서는 주문 상태 확인, 반품 절차 안내, 제품 정보 제공 등의 서비스를 ChatGPT를 통해 자동화할 수 있습니다.

2. 교육

ChatGPT는 교육 분야에서도 큰 잠재력을 가지고 있습니다. 학생들이 질문을 하면 즉각적으로 답변을 제공하거나, 특정 주제에 대한 설명을 해줄 수 있습니다. 이는 학생들이 학습하는 데 필요한 정보를 신속하게 얻을 수 있도록 도와줍니다. 또한, 개인 튜터 역할을 하여 학생들이 이해하지 못한 부분을 보충 설명해줄 수도 있습니다.

3. 콘텐츠 생성

블로그 포스트, 소셜 미디어 게시물, 마케팅 카피 등 다양한 콘텐츠를 생성하는 데에도 ChatGPT가 활용될 수 있습니다. 사용자는 특정 주제에 대한 아이디어를 요청하거나, 특정 형식의 글을 작성해달라고 요구할 수 있습니다. ChatGPT는 이러한 요청에 기반하여 창의적이고 유익한 콘텐츠를 생성할 수 있습니다.

4. 언어 번역

ChatGPT는 다양한 언어를 이해하고 생성할 수 있는 능력을 가지고 있어, 언어 번역에도 활용될 수 있습니다. 사용자가 특정 문장을 다른 언어로 번역해달라고 요청하면, ChatGPT는 그 요청에 따라 자연스러운 번역 결과를 제공할 수 있습니다. 이는 다국적 기업이나 여행객들에게 매우 유용한 기능이 될 것입니다.

5. 게임 개발

게임 개발 분야에서도 ChatGPT는 흥미로운 활용 가능성을 보여줍니다. NPC(Non-Playable Character)와의 대화를 자연스럽게 만들거나, 스토리라인을 생성하는 데 도움을 줄 수 있습니다. 플레이어가 NPC와 상호작용할 때, ChatGPT는 상황에 맞는 유의미한 대화를 생성하여 게임의 몰입도를 높일 수 있습니다.

6. 심리 상담

최근에는 ChatGPT를 활용한 심리 상담 서비스도 등장하고 있습니다. 사용자가 자신의 감정이나 고민을 털어놓으면, ChatGPT는 공감적인 응답을 제공하고, 필요한 경우 적절한 조언을 해줄 수 있습니다. 물론, 이는 전문 상담사의 역할을 대체하는 것이 아니라, 보조적인 역할로 사용될 수 있습니다.

결론

ChatGPT는 인공지능 기술의 발전을 통해 사람들과의 소통 방식에 혁신을 가져오고 있습니다. 다양한 분야에서의 활용 가능성 덕분에 앞으로도 많은 사람들에게 유용한 도구로 자리 잡을 것입니다. 그러나 AI 챗봇의 사용에는 윤리적 고려와 함께, 사람과의 소통이 가지는 고유한 가치를 잊지 않는 것이 중요합니다. AI는 인간의 삶을 더욱 풍요롭게 하는 도구로 활용되어야 하며, 그 과정에서 인간의 감정과 관계를 존중하는 것이 필요합니다. ChatGPT와 같은 AI 기술이 우리의 삶에 긍정적인 영향을 미칠 수 있도록, 우리는 지속적으로 그 활용 방법을 고민하고 발전시켜 나가야 할 것입니다.